Smile Cookies campaign underway

Tim Hortons partners up with the East Kootenay Foundation for Health and the Cranbrook Health Care Auxiliary

It is that time of year again for Smile Cookies at Tim Horton’s!

Beginning today (September 11), both locations of Cranbrook Tim Hortons will be selling these yummy cookies for only $1.

You will also find the Cranbrook Health Care Auxiliary selling them in the lobby of the hospital.  And, if you really like them, The East Kootenay Foundation for Health will be selling whole cases of cookies for $140.

All of the proceeds from the Smile Cookie Campaign in Cranbrook will go directly to the East Kootenay Regional Hospital in support of purchasing much needed equipment.

At the same time, it was the Foundations intention to work with local business and provide cookies directly to the fire crews fighting the fires around Cranbrook, just to say thank you for their tireless efforts. But after speaking with the BC Wildfire Service, for many practical reasons we are unable to do that. Instead, the BC Wildfire Service has asked us all to eat these cookies in their honour, or buy a whole case and give them to your family, friends, favourite group or customers.
